Reverse description The denomination numeral '5' is rendered in large, bold relief at the center of the field, dominating the design. The curved legend CINCO CENTAVOS arcs along the upper periphery in raised Latin lettering. Two small sprigs of laurel or grain flank the base of the numeral at lower left and right. The four-digit date appears in the lower exergual area, beneath the sprigs, completing the reverse design in a clean and utilitarian style.
